1zzfe silicone radiator hoses


Recommended Posts

Have used them, they're not too bad, not really worth the effort over the stock hoses IMO.

If you're cutting up hoses to fit a water temp sender for aftermarket guage or similar then it saves chopping up the stock hoses.

their quality control is a bit hit and miss, you find this out when you order multiple sets at once. Some can have thin/soft spots where they miss stop/start the winding mid-piece. All luck of the draw really. We got 3 sets and 1 had a soft-spot mid hose, didn't matter too much as that part was cut out to fit a sender adapter.

update: hoses have arived and have been installed

overall i was impressed with the kit, fit was perfect and the silicon was triple layered where the the stock hoses are double rubber style, has a good shiny finish with obx printed on both hoses. would i recomend these? yes, there not a huge difference over stock apart from looking the goods. overall id rate them 8/10 if i had to be picky id say they could of come with some aftermarket clamps and the packageing was poor. ;)

but like CHA54 said be prepered for flat spots in ths product as he has had this problem, or could of been a one off i dont know, mine were ok.
